Super Typhoon Fung-wong Slams Philippines, Prompting Urgent Evacuations

As of November 9th, 2025, the Philippines is bracing for the impact of Super Typhoon Fung-wong, the biggest storm to threaten the country this year. The typhoon, with winds of up to 185 kph (115 mph) and gusts of up to 230 kph (143 mph), has already started battering the country's northeastern coast ahead of its expected landfall on Sunday or early Monday.
